 I have another datapoint that is interesting. This problem does not appear to 
 be even FreeBSD specific.
 
 I bought two of these devices. One of them was plugged into the FreeBSD 
 machine (as per previous post). The second one I was holding off on. But 
 today I inserted it into an OpenSolaris machine (NexentaOS_20061012), and am 
 experiencing almost EXACTLY the same problem.
 
 The kernel will detect the presence of it immediately, but trying to list 
 contents of /devices/pci_(_at_)__(_dot_)__(_dot_)__(_dot_)_ just leads to a hang. Until about 25 minutes or 
 so later when the kernel reports that the device is "online", and /devices 
 stops hanging (and rmformat etc works again).
 
 Someone correct me if I am wrong, but isn't the Solaris USB implementation 
 100% independent of the FreeBSD implementation? If so, and given the very 
 specific and IMO weird symptom of this bug, does not this indicate there may 
 be an actual bug in the device (even if it's not triggered in Windows or 
 Linux)?
